Welcome to Side Project Brewing What began as a dream and a side project has now grown into our 100% barrel-aged brewery. Passion, experimentation and patience drive the creation of our rustic Saisons, Wild Ales and Spirit Barrel-Aged Ales. As we share our craft with you, we hope you share it with your friends as well.

Blend 9, March 2020, draught at the brewery 12/26/22. Good clarity, peach-bronze-maize. Large white head slowly to ring. Lovely grains, light Brett and soft, but moderately strong oak. Low fruitiness but tons of plastery/waxy saison character with light black pepper. Hint of unripe peach skin on the end. Clean, no alcohol. Soft and wheaty, chewy and nicely attenuated with rounded, but prevalent oak. Lovely stone fruit and good but not strong acidity on the end. If you told me there was apricot in this I'd believe you, which is cool. I like how strong the saison character is. And the stone fruit. And the mild oak. Crazy that this is only 4%
